## Step 4: Configure the resize worker

Shrinkray is the batch image-resizing CLI maintained by the Ostervale tools team. Support staff deploying it on a shared host should install the binary to /opt/shrinkray and create a .env file alongside it. The file holds the output bucket name, concurrency limit, and default quality setting, all documented in the sample file. The last required entry is the storage access key, which goes on the next line.

sealed setting: VAULT_KEY20=c8ea1e419912889df6b4

OFF-SITE RUN — CHECKLIST ITEM 4

Notarised deed for the Varnell Quay acquisition leaves with the morning run. Deed is in the grey tamper-evident folder, sealed by Legal last night. Do not open, do not photocopy, do not bag with general post. Confirm seal intact before release. Courier from Bramhold Express arrives between 07:30 and 08:00; only the pre-cleared rider takes it. Log time of release in the run sheet. The courier hand-over instruction for this item is stated on the line below.

courier memo of yahif-faweg: the quenael tamius courier leaves the prawyn jorix kaswyn istox silmir brieth zormir fenvan ledger at gate 3145 under passcode 231062

### Why does the catalogue import skip some MARC records?

Good question — the Shelfwren importer drops records missing a valid control number rather than guessing. You'll see them in the skipped-records report, not silently lost. If your review branch changes that behavior, flag it loudly in the PR description. For weird edge cases the fixtures don't cover, ask the catalogue data steward before merging.

escalation mailbox, yajeg-bageg: quenax.olidor@lumiccorp.internal